Block walls serve both functional and visual purposes in landscaping, providing structure, privacy, and visual interest to outside areas. These walls can be used to keep soil on sloped residential or commercial properties, specify garden beds, or create clear limits within a landscape. The option of block type-- concrete, interlocking, or decorative-- impacts both the strength and look of the wall. Correct preparation guarantees stability, especially for taller walls, with considerations for drain, support, and soil pressure. Installation starts with a well-prepared base, frequently involving excavation and leveling to ensure the wall remains straight and steady in time. Mortar or adhesive may be used depending upon the block type, and reinforcement like rebar can boost sturdiness. A knowledgeable landscaper guarantees each course is level and aligned, avoiding future moving or splitting. Block walls likewise offer creative chances through finishes, textures, and colors, enabling them to complement the surrounding landscape. Integrating lighting, planters, or cascading plants can soften the hard edges, making the wall both practical and visually attractive. Routine examinations and small repair work help keep the wall's stability for several years to come
